How our Lungs Work
In school today we learned how our lungs work. We cut the base of a plastic bottle and attached a balloon to the top. We cut a second balloon and sellotaped it around the base, ensuring it was air-tight. This balloon represents the diaphragm and when it is pulled down air enters the top balloon (the lungs). When the diaphragm is pushed up air is expelled from the lungs.
